2. Enjoy Fall Fun at Dollywood

Great Pumpkin LumiNights at Dollywood

During fall, Pigeon Forge is home to fun, seasonal events. One event you don’t want to miss is the Harvest Festival at Dollywood! This popular event features impressive fall decorations, live gospel, country, and bluegrass music, fall-flavored treats, and more. You’ll want to be sure you stay until the sun goes down to enjoy the magic of Great Pumpkin LumiNights! Thousands of carved pumpkins and larger-than-life pumpkin displays light up the park, and visitors can enjoy everything from a giant pumpkin spider to glowing owls. While you’re there, don’t miss the chance to try some of their world-famous cinnamon bread or 25-pound apple pie!

3. Take in the Fall Foliage

Your visit to Pigeon Forge wouldn’t be complete without taking in views of the stunning fall foliage. During the season, the leaves transform from green to beautiful shades of red, orange, and yellow. Whether you’re interested in going for a scenic drive and witnessing the scenery from the comfort of your car or going for a hike through the Smoky Mountains, you’re in for a treat. You can go for a stroll along the Riverwalk Trail in Pigeon Forge, or take a drive into Cades Cove in the Great Smoky Mountains National Park! Looking for a more thrilling way to discover the fall views? See the sights from new heights on a ride at Dollywood, like Drop Line or Wild Eagle! Even just driving down the Pigeon Forge Parkway will offer great views of the fall colors in the Smoky Mountains.
